你查询的IP:[121.4.229.235]  地理位置:中国–上海–上海

最新查询60.200.234.18 123.249.195.34 58.128.227.155 221.129.65.195 123.137.211.52 218.64.77.103 210.2.112.125 121.40.75.35 219.216.211.43 121.4.229.235 117.124.250.253 210.56.192.70 120.30.170.191 202.91.176.223 119.88.59.103 124.112.93.228 125.98.86.1 114.68.142.133 117.80.144.182 117.53.48.176 59.80.147.100 119.28.31.100 121.32.36.239 202.14.88.183 61.232.39.98 202.90.252.231 203.156.192.241 202.127.112.84 203.93.187.210 203.83.56.224 114.54.134.84